Syrian Officials Deny Responsibility for Houla Massacre
Voice of America
Syrian officials say Damascus is not responsible for the massacre in a village that killed at least 92 people, including dozens of children. A Foreign Ministry spokesman, Jihad Makdissi, told reporters in Damascus Sunday that anti-government gunmen ...

Activists: Syria Attacks Continue
Wall Street Journal
AP BEIRUTâ€"Government troops shelled residential areas in central Syria on Sunday, activists said, two days after the bombardment of a string of villages in the same region killed more than 90, many of them children. Friday's assault on Houla, ...

Syria massacre: William Hague steps up pressure
BBC News
Foreign Secretary William Hague has summoned Syria's most senior diplomat in the UK to the Foreign Office, over the massacre in Houla. It comes as the UK works to "galvanise the international approach" to the Syrian regime's actions.
